ADLINK PCI-6216V-GL - 51-12201-0C30 16-CH 16-Bit Voltage Analog Output Card

The ADLINK PCI-6216V-GL is a high-performance multifunction data acquisition (DAQ) card designed specifically for demanding environments such as the power industry, petrochemical plants, and general automation systems. Engineered for precision, durability, and efficiency, this model offers a robust solution for complex measurement and control tasks, making it a cornerstone in the suite of ADLINK automation products. At its core, the PCI-6216V-GL features 16 analog input channels with 16-bit resolution and up to 250 kS/s sampling rate, enabling highly accurate and fast data acquisition. It also supports 2 analog outputs and 24 digital I/O lines, providing versatile interfacing options for various sensors and actuators. The card’s input range is programmable, accommodating ±10 V, ±5 V, ±2 V, and ±1 V, which ensures flexibility to adapt to different signal levels. Built with galvanic isolation, the PCI-6216V-GL safeguards sensitive electronics from voltage spikes and noise, significantly improving signal integrity and system reliability in harsh industrial environments.
